Don't simulate your entire factory on day one. Pick one problematic cell—perhaps the one that crashes most often or the bottleneck station. Simulate it, optimize it, then deploy the code to the real robot. Measure the improvement (usually 15-30% cycle time reduction).

For logistics companies, CIROS generates optimal picking patterns. It calculates the inverse kinematics for stacking boxes of varying sizes, ensuring the vacuum gripper never drops a load due to incorrect approach angles.

Ciros Robotics specializes in modular automation — think robotic cells, mobile manipulators, and vision-guided systems designed for SMEs and large enterprises alike. Their core focus is reducing the gap between traditional industrial robots (complex, expensive, hard to reprogram) and collaborative robots (limited payload/speed).

Key distinction: Ciros systems often emphasize software-first integration, meaning you can repurpose a single robot arm for welding, packing, or machine tending within hours, not weeks.
